Why is teen crashes and collision a problem especially for teen drivers?

Teen crashes and collisions are a significant problem due to several factors, including inexperience, risk-taking behaviors, and distractions such as mobile devices. Young drivers often lack the skills to respond effectively to hazardous situations, which can lead to poor decision-making while driving. Additionally, the combination of peer pressure and a desire for independence can further exacerbate risky driving behaviors, resulting in higher accident rates among this age group. As a result, teen drivers are disproportionately involved in crashes compared to more experienced drivers.

How many crashes are caused by teen drivers?

Around 14% of all crashes involve teen drivers, even though they make up only about 6% of total drivers. Teen drivers are more likely to be involved in crashes due to factors like inexperience, distracted driving, and risk-taking behavior.

Unintentional injury accounts for the majority of teen fatalities each year what is the leading cause of these death?

Motor vehicle crashes are the leading cause of unintentional injury-related teen fatalities each year. Factors such as inexperience, distracted driving, and impaired driving contribute to the high rate of teen deaths in motor vehicle accidents.
